At Mon, 8 Nov 1999, Michele wrote: >
>My husband and I conceived our first child on our first try (Aug. 14).
>Unfortunately I had a miscarriage on September 17. I was just wondering
>if conceiving on your first try is common and if it has happened to alot
>of women. We've decided to try again and I should have ovulated on
>November 6th. What are the odds I could be pregnant again on the first
>try? I don't want to get my hopes up, but my lower back feels sore and I
>have a headache (which were early symptoms of my previous pregnancy...)
>Is it just wishful thinking? I know I should wait until my period is due
>to do a hpt.

The rate of pregnancy in any particular month is about 10-15% thereby giving a rate of 85% by six months. After that is slacks off quite a bit to reach 92% by 12 months.
